Wait...what do YOU mean....

The receiver is the hitch...the part the bolts to the truck.

The ball mount and draw bar / hitch insert is the part that the ball bolts to and is removable.

Yes.......curt 14374 would have been better (rated 1,000 tongue, 10,000 total normal, or 1,200 tongue, 12,000 towing with WDH)


The kind you got in curt is rated 600 lbs tongue 6,000 lbs towing normal, and 1,000 tongue, and 10,000 towing with WDH


It'll work as long as your truck has the plate & tube already under it, which I think they do these days.
